Although water is very useful in daily activities around the home, it is equally destructive if spilled uncontrollably. The good thing about water is its colorless and odorless nature when clean, so restoring an affected property mostly involves drying wet materials and contents. Some cases of water damage, however, are not straightforward because of some tricky issues.

The levels of water damage in your home vary depending on what happens after the water spills. If water removal in your Davie property happens fast, the spilled water might be removed while still on the surface of the materials. Even if absorbed, extraction and other drying procedures can remove it quickly. However, in some cases, especially when water spills affected wood, the absorbed water can form chemical bonds with the material, thus preventing regular evaporation patterns. There is a need to break the chemical bonds and dry the wood to prevent long-term problems such as rotting or warping. Our SERVPRO technicians heat the wood to break the bonds. Heating also creates enormous vapor pressure in the deeper layers removing moisture through vapor diffusion.

Air plays a vital role during the drying process by holding and transporting the moisture removed from materials. The way air interacts with other aspects of drying, such as temperature, can slow the drying process. As water evaporates from a material, the air next to the surface can become cooler; forming what is known as a boundary layer. The boundary layer ends up saturated with moisture stopping the evaporation process altogether, thus impeding drying. Our SERVPRO technicians are aware of such behavior. That is why we use air movers and even heaters to keep the drying process in-track.

Water removal should happen in a timely yet controlled manner. Taking too long can cause permanent issues such as carpets delaminating or crowning and buckling on wooden floors, among other issues. Working too fast, especially during the drying phase, can make materials crack or warp. Our SERVPRO technicians assess the situation and set manageable drying goals.
